Title: Einar Orn Fridjonsson: Innovator in NMR Technology
Introduction
Einar Orn Fridjonsson is a notable inventor based in Lesmurdie, Australia. He has made significant contributions to the field of nuclear magnetic resonance (NMR) technology, holding a total of four patents. His work focuses on enhancing the measurement and analysis of multiphase fluid flows, which is crucial in various industrial applications.
Latest Patents
One of Fridjonsson's latest patents is titled "Liquid NMR signal boost during NMR flow metering of wet gas flow using enhanced signal relaxation and/or dynamic nuclear polarization using immobilized radicals." This innovative multiphase flow metering device features a conduit for fluid flow and a structured packing insert designed to optimize the measurement of fluid properties. The device includes a Halbach pre-polarizing magnet array, an RF coil, and an NMR console, all configured to detect NMR signals from the multiphase fluid. The incorporation of immobilized radicals allows for dynamic nuclear polarization, enhancing the accuracy of fluid property measurements.
Career Highlights
Fridjonsson has worked with prominent organizations, including the Saudi Arabian Oil Company and the University of Western Australia. His experience in these institutions has allowed him to develop and refine his innovative technologies, contributing to advancements in the field of fluid dynamics and NMR applications.
